In 2020, Beacon Lighting deployed Nimbus Scheduling, implementing Nimbus Time2Work across its Australian store network to standardise scheduling and rostering practices. The engagement is categorized under Advanced Planning and Scheduling and focused on centralizing roster management and enforcing award rule compliance across retail sites.
The implementation configured award compliant rostering, mobile shift notifications, and automated schedule generation to reduce manual roster preparation. Nimbus Scheduling was integrated with ADP payroll to streamline time capture and payroll data flow, and the solution leveraged mobile access for employee shift notifications and manager approvals to improve schedule adherence.
Operational scope covered store operations, HR and payroll functions across Australia, with governance centered on standardized scheduling rules and automated compliance checks. According to the vendor case study, the deployment delivered time savings and greater payroll confidence, and it improved operational efficiency and staff engagement by reducing manual tasks and providing mobile shift notifications.

In 2021, BINGO Industries deployed Nimbus Scheduling in an Advanced Planning and Scheduling implementation focused on workforce rostering, time and attendance and payroll accuracy. BINGO Industries implemented Nimbus Scheduling, leveraging the nimbus Time2Work module to centralize roster creation and automate shift notifications across its Australian operations.
The implementation configured rostering automation, time and attendance capture, rules based compliance checks, and shift notification workflows. Nimbus Scheduling and the nimbus Time2Work capability were used to manage roster templates, shift swaps, attendance reconciliation, and automated alerts, replacing manual spreadsheet based rostering processes.
The deployment integrated nimbus Time2Work with NoahFace facial recognition clocking for biometric time capture, an explicit integration that reduced time fraud and improved payroll accuracy according to the vendor case study. Operational scope included HR, operations scheduling and payroll related functions across BINGO Industries sites in Australia.
Governance changes included centralized roster approval workflows and automated attendance reconciliation to support payroll accuracy and compliance reporting. The vendor case study reports outcomes of reduced time fraud, streamlined shift notifications, improved rostering automation, enhanced compliance and removal of reliance on manual spreadsheets.

In 2017 Serco implemented Nimbus Scheduling to support its Prisoner Escort & Custody Services operations in South England, using the vendor's Nimbus Time2Work scheduling and rostering capabilities for HR and workforce scheduling. The deployment targeted a safety-critical public sector operation and was scoped to improve staff scheduling, time and attendance, and on-the-day shift management across PECS sites in the United Kingdom.
The implementation emphasized Advanced Planning and Scheduling functionality, with explicit use of scheduling and rostering modules, time and attendance capture, automated approval workflows and on-the-day shift management controls. Configuration work included roster generation logic, exception handling and approval routing to reduce manual administration and standardize shift assignments.
Operational coverage was concentrated on PECS operations in South England, delivering centralized visibility and operational control for operations managers and workforce administrators. Governance changes accompanied the technical rollout, establishing centralized approval workflows and revised on-duty management procedures to align scheduling processes with compliance requirements in a safety-sensitive environment.
The deployment produced centralized visibility, automated approvals and reduced manual admin, strengthening compliance and operational control for Serco's PECS operations as documented in the vendor case study. Nimbus Scheduling, implemented via Nimbus Time2Work functionality, became the core Advanced Planning and Scheduling platform for Serco's UK prisoner escort scheduling and day-of-shift management.
